This paper presents the fundamental principles of traffic flow modeling and proposes the computer simulation implementation methods consisting of three modules: vehicle generation, speed discrete distribution and vehicle motion. A microscopic simulation approach of freeway traffic flow based on cellular automata and the relevant technical process are established and then tested in the typical sections of the Xihai Freeway in the Jiangxi Province of China. According to the results, the proposed traffic flow simulation technique can precisely represent the complicated dynamic performances of a freeway system. This technique provides a new, efficient approach to the microscopic simulation of freeway traffic flow.
Using a Cellular Automata Model to Simulate Freeway Traffic
